Learn more about Greencastle

This charming harbour town invites you to explore its maritime heritage at the Greencastle Maritime Museum and Fort. Take a boat tour from the working fishing port or enjoy fresh seafood while watching colourful vessels bob in the harbour.

Things to do in and around Greencastle

Greencastle, County Donegal, is perfect for an eco-friendly family getaway, boasting activities like golf at Redcastle Golf Club and the Discover Greencastle Golf Club. Enjoy scenic hiking trails and explore local attractions that highlight the area's natural beauty. Day trips offer further adventures, making Greencastle an ideal destination for outdoor enthusiasts.

Shopping

In Greencastle, explore local shops for unique gifts and souvenirs. For a broader selection, if you’re up for a drive, head to the nearby town of Moville for the bustling Moville Market, or check out the retail options at the Quayside Shopping Centre in Donegal Town.

Recreation

Greencastle Golf Club offers a stunning golf experience amidst beautiful landscapes, perfect for outdoor enthusiasts. Just 27.4km away, Ballyliffin Golf Course boasts picturesque views and challenging holes, providing an invigorating escape for golfers looking to relax and enjoy nature.

Adventure

Explore the stunning landscapes of Malin Head, the northernmost point of Ireland, where rugged cliffs meet the Atlantic Ocean, perfect for hiking and photography. Engage in water sports at Greencastle Marina, offering kayaking and sailing for a thrilling experience on the water.

Nightlife

Experience the lively nightlife in Greencastle by visiting The Frontier Bar for a friendly atmosphere and a pint of locally brewed stout. For some traditional music, stop by The O'Gara's Pub, where you can enjoy the tunes and mingle with locals after a day of exploring.

Best time to go to Greencastle

The best time to visit Greencastle can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Greencastle falls in July, when visitor numbers are moderately high and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Greencastle falls in January, visitor numbers are moderately low and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January40.5°F (4.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owSlightly Low
February41.2°F (5.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
March42.8°F (6.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
April46.4°F (8.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
May50.7°F (10.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
June55.4°F (13.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High
July57.6°F (14.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High
August57.2°F (14.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High
September54.9°F (12.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
October50.4°F (10.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
November45.1°F (7.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owSlightly Low
December41.5°F (5.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owAverage

The nearest major airports for your trip to Greencastle

To reach Greencastle, County Donegal, you can fly into two major airports. Donegal Airport (CFN) is situated 90.1km away, with nearby accommodation options like the 4-star Waterfront Hotel Dungloe, 9.7km from the airport, and An Chúirt Hotel, 8.0km away. Both hotels offer transportation services to Donegal Airport for a fee. Alternatively, Letterkenny Airfield (LTR) is 54.7km from Greencastle, with excellent hotel choices such as the 4.5-star Rockhill House, just 6.4km away, and the Clanree Hotel & Leisure Centre, a mere mile from the airfield, both providing easy access to the airport.

What's the seasonal weather like in Greencastle?
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 13°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 5°C. Average annual precipitation for Greencastle is 1007 mm.
